Handwriting - The Blessing of the 'HaNoten Tshuah'. Germany, 1800s
HaNoten Tshuah LaMelachim - 'who gives salvation to kings' - a handwritten blessing , written for the peace of Clemens Wenceslaus of Saxony - Prince-Bishop of Augsburg from 1768 until 1812 when he went to war in Trier in West Germany. handsome scribal script, dotted writing. The title, the emperor's name, and illustrations in red ink.
28x21 cm. Thick paper. Good condition.
